ENI, Vitol win new oil block in Ghana
Eni and its partner Vitol have been awarded rights to Block WB03, located in the medium deep waters of the prolific Tano Basin, offshore Ghana. Stakeholders disappointed with low number of bids for new oil blocks
Stakeholders in the oil and gas sector have expressed their disappointment in the low number bids submitted for the 3 oil blocks put up for competitive bidding by the Government. Revised Petroleum Agreement will be beneficial to Ghana–AGM
Norwegian oil company, AGM has described a revised petroleum agreement it has with Ghana as a good deal that will enable the country benefit from exploration of oil.
